The Opportunity:
We are seeking a passionate and inspirational Secondary Music Teacher to join our dynamic Creative Arts Department. The role involves teaching Music to students from Years 6-11, with the potential to teach A Level Music from 2027-28. The successful candidate will play a key role in inspiring students and delivering high-quality learning experiences.
